Common Names: selfheal, allheal, lance lelfheal, aleutian selfheal, heal-all, carpenter-weed, heart-of-the-earth
The fact that there are both native and alien members of this species has caused it to be a difficult plant to classify as a weed or a wildflower. This short, fibrous rooted perennial often occurs in lawns or pastures, and the terminal spike-like clusters of blue to purple irregular flowers are quite distinctive.
